About Budurlal Vidya Niketan

College Overview

Budurlal Vidya Niketan, situated in the heart of Hadiya, Chaudandigadhi-9, Udayapur, stands as a beacon of academic excellence and social transformation in the Koshi Province of Nepal. Established with a vision to provide accessible and high-quality education to the rural and semi-urban population of the Udayapur district, this institution has evolved into one of the most respected community-based educational centers in the region.

The history of Budurlal Vidya Niketan is deeply rooted in the collective efforts of local educationists and community leaders who recognized the need for an institution that could bridge the gap between traditional learning and modern academic requirements. Since its inception, the school has focused on nurturing the intellectual and moral development of its students, ensuring they are well-prepared for both higher education and professional challenges.

The mission of Budurlal Vidya Niketan is to provide a holistic learning environment where students from diverse backgrounds can thrive. The institution's vision is to become a leading center for academic innovation in eastern Nepal, emphasizing character building, critical thinking, and social responsibility. Its academic strengths lie in its dedicated faculty, community-centric approach, and a curriculum that balances theoretical knowledge with practical skills.

University Affiliations & Recognition

Primary Affiliation

National Examination Board (NEB)

Budurlal Vidya Niketan is officially affiliated with the National Examination Board (NEB) of Nepal for its secondary and higher secondary (+2) programs.

  • Affiliation Type: Permanent
  • Accreditation: Ministry of Education, Nepal
  • Programs: Management, Education, Humanities
Recognition

Ministry of Education, Science and Technology

The institution is fully recognized by the Government of Nepal, ensuring that all degrees and certificates issued are valid for civil service and international higher education.

  • Status: Community School
  • Regional Coverage: Udayapur District
  • Quality Standards: Government Audited

Programs Offered by National Examination Board (NEB)

Budurlal Vidya Niketan offers specialized tracks at the +2 level designed to prepare students for specific career paths and university degrees.

Management

Focused on business principles, accounting, and economics.

  • Duration: 2 Years
  • Degree: Higher Secondary Certificate
  • Eligibility: Minimum D+ or equivalent in SEE

Career Opportunities:

Banking, Business Administration, Accounting, Entrepreneurship.

Education

Designed for future educators and pedagogical researchers.

  • Duration: 2 Years
  • Degree: Higher Secondary Certificate
  • Eligibility: Minimum D+ or equivalent in SEE

Career Opportunities:

Teaching, School Administration, Curriculum Development, Counseling.

Humanities

A broad track covering sociology, Nepali, and social sciences.

  • Duration: 2 Years
  • Degree: Higher Secondary Certificate
  • Eligibility: Minimum D+ or equivalent in SEE

Career Opportunities:

Social Work, Journalism, Public Relations, Local Government.

Fee Structure

Program University/Board Duration Admission Fee Monthly Fee Total Estimated (Per Year)
+2 Management NEB 2 Years NPR 4,500 NPR 1,200 NPR 18,900
+2 Education NEB 2 Years NPR 3,500 NPR 800 NPR 13,100
+2 Humanities NEB 2 Years NPR 3,500 NPR 800 NPR 13,100

* Fees are subject to change based on government directives and school management committee decisions. Scholarship recipients may receive significant waivers.

Admission Process

The admission process at Budurlal Vidya Niketan is transparent and based on merit. Prospective students must meet the following criteria:

  • Completion of SEE (Secondary Education Examination) or equivalent.
  • Minimum GPA requirements as specified by NEB for each stream.
  • Successful completion of the school's internal entrance interview.

Required Documents:

  • Certified copy of SEE Grade Sheet.
  • SEE Character Certificate.
  • Transfer Certificate (if applicable).
  • Passport-sized photographs.
  • Citizenship/Birth Certificate copy.

Application Steps:

  1. Visit the school office during admission hours.
  2. Purchase and fill out the official application form.
  3. Submit documents and the application fee.
  4. Appear for the entrance screening/interview.
  5. Confirmation of admission upon fee payment.

Scholarships & Financial Assistance

Budurlal Vidya Niketan is committed to ensuring that no talented student is deprived of education due to financial constraints.

Merit-Based Scholarships

Available for students who achieve outstanding results in the SEE or internal examinations.

Need-Based Financial Aid

Targeted support for students from economically disadvantaged families, including waivers on monthly fees.

Social Inclusion Grants

Special scholarships for students from marginalized communities (Dalit, Janajati, Madhesi) as per government guidelines.

Government Scholarships

Distribution of government-funded stipends for eligible students according to state regulations.
